Energy-efficient thermal-aware multiprocessor scheduling for real-time tasks using TCPNs
Resumen: We present an energy-effcient thermal-aware real-time global scheduler for a set of hard real-time (HRT) tasks running on a multiprocessor system. This global scheduler fulfills the thermal and temporal constraints by handling two independent variables, the task allocation time and the selection of clock frequency. To achieve its goal, the proposed scheduler is split into two stages. An off-line stage, based on a deadline partitioning scheme, computes the cycles that the HRT tasks must run per deadline interval at the minimum clock frequency to save energy while honoring the temporal and thermal constraints, and computes the maximum frequency at which the system can run below the maximum temperature. Then, an on-line, event-driven stage performs global task allocation applying a Fixed-Priority Zero-Laxity policy, reducing the overhead of quantum-based or interval-based global schedulers. The on-line stage embodies an adaptive scheduler that accepts or rejects soft RT aperiodic tasks throttling CPU frequency to the upper lowest available one to minimize power consumption while meeting time and thermal constraints. This approach leverages the best of two worlds: the off-line stage computes an ideal discrete HRT multiprocessor schedule, while the on-line stage manage soft real-time aperiodic tasks with minimum power consumption and maximum CPU utilization.
Idioma: Inglés
DOI: 10.1007/s10626-019-00285-x
Año: 2019
Publicado en: DISCRETE EVENT DYNAMIC SYSTEMS-THEORY AND APPLICATIONS 29, 3 (2019), 237–264
ISSN: 0924-6703

Factor impacto JCR: 0.932 (2019)
Categ. JCR: MATHEMATICS, APPLIED rank: 170 / 260 = 0.654 (2019) - Q3 - T2
Categ. JCR: OPERATIONS RESEARCH & MANAGEMENT SCIENCE rank: 72 / 83 = 0.867 (2019) - Q4 - T3
Categ. JCR: AUTOMATION & CONTROL SYSTEMS rank: 56 / 63 = 0.889 (2019) - Q4 - T3

Factor impacto SCIMAGO: 0.718 - Electrical and Electronic Engineering (Q1) - Modeling and Simulation (Q2) - Control and Systems Engineering (Q2)

Financiación: info:eu-repo/grantAgreement/ES/DGA-FEDER/Construyendo Europa desde Aragón
Financiación: info:eu-repo/grantAgreement/ES/DGA/T58-17R
Financiación: info:eu-repo/grantAgreement/ES/MINECO/TIN2016-76635-C2-1-R
Tipo y forma: Article (PostPrint)
Área (Departamento): Área Arquit.Tecnología Comput. (Dpto. Informát.Ingenie.Sistms.)

Rights Reserved All rights reserved by journal editor


Exportado de SIDERAL (2020-07-27-11:09:52)


Visitas y descargas

Este artículo se encuentra en las siguientes colecciones:
Articles



 Record created 2020-07-27, last modified 2020-07-27


Postprint:
 PDF
Rate this document:

Rate this document:
1
2
3
 
(Not yet reviewed)